Key Factors to Consider for Hiring Offshore Development Partner

With the rise in internet activities businesses have crossed the country borders, which has led to great changes in software development. Now software teams have been linked to cities, nations and ocean. The offshore development companies in Asia and Eastern Europe provides software development services at 1/4th the cost of on-shore software development. Moreover, technological innovations have also made this business communication easy. There are several online platforms from where you can easily find companies and even freelancers to outsource your project with complete security of your money.

More and more companies are going for offshoring because they are able to get high-quality programming talent within their budget or even less than that and more time to concentrate on core competencies. The major task in software development is aligning people, their knowledge, and your business objectives. There are a few things that you need to consider before you outsource your project to an offshore software development company.

What is vendor’s core competency?

Your decision of outsourcing your project is simply because you are looking for expertise help to complete it. Therefore, you need to find out a vendor whose core competency is website and application development. If their focus is at one service, they will give their 100% on your product.

Are they offering budget-friendly services?

When you choose to outsource your work, you will get to work with the offshore companies in two ways: hourly or fixed price. You can ask for the total project price if it is a short-term or one-time work. But if your work is a long time and will continue for many more months to come, then you should prefer to get work done on an hourly basis. Before finalizing your deal, get all the paperwork done in advance and that too in a proper manner to avoid any issues.

Do they have sufficient experience?

Don’t forget to consider the experience of the outsourcing company. Make sure it is sufficient for the web development. If the vendor has a good experience, then it will truly reflect in their work.

Did you check their reputation?

It is extremely important that before you finalize anything, you must check the reputation of the company. Check their Google or Facebook reviews. Find out what their customers have to say about them. Their past clients are their true testimonials. They can tell you more about the company and how good they are at their work.

Once you consider all these factors, it will be easy for you to decide which company you would like to hire. You need to search an outsourcing company that is fit for your organization and the task you want to get completed.

Make Your Web Projects A Success With Ruby Developers

Every developer wants programming for web applications to remain as simple as it can get. Most of them want to work with a framework that is simple and easy to use. Similarly, every business wants a technology that helps it save time and cost for its web development projects. This is where Ruby on Rails comes into picture as it’s a popular web application development framework used extensively these days across industry verticals for web projects. The framework is very helpful to developers as it does not force them to write lines of codes for adding features and functionalities in websites and applications of clients’ projects.

More so, developers find this framework not only extremely simple to work with but also fun for development purposes. The framework is hot at the moment as it comes packed with an array of helpful features to add tremendous value to websites and online applications. For web applications, Ruby on Rails is considered just perfect as it fetches a working prototype in a super quick time. It also gives developers the ease of checking the feasibility of web projects in a hassle-free and easy manner. The best part, it allows fixing of cracks in the development cycle early on – something not available with other frameworks.

Furthermore, businesses find Ruby on Rails quite favourable as it helps them save a lot of money with their web projects. It’s 100% free and this makes it one of most cost-effective frameworks around for businesses to meet their web development goals in an economical manner. It runs on the open source Linux and developers face absolutely no issue in working with this framework. More so, developers using this framework move from the planning to actual development stage in a swift manner and this has a lot to do with the easy handling that it offers. This is how a great deal of time is saved with projects.

In addition, the framework is supported by an active and helpful community where developers are always ready to troubleshoot problems of any nature and help people working on projects. It’s the efforts of community that sees a drastic improvement in the code and this is how the framework becomes more robust and popular for users and businesses alike. More so, projects that use Ruby on Rails never face problems when taken from one developer to another as coding conventions are followed in building them. Since this framework is easy and simple to work, projects will always have a viability in future.

Furthermore, Ruby on Rails is one of those technologies that help one build their own plug and play apps without seeking external support. Which means, future projects can be sustained on the basis of elements of existing projects and developers will be saved the inconvenience of doing things from the scratch. More so, this framework lets your apps to serve multiple purposes together with being expandable. Quite clearly, the list of features is just too much to ignore and you should thus hire ruby developers to benefit from them all.

How to Develop iPhone Programs and Apps

Are you interested in developing an app for the iPhone? These apps are a major way to making heaps of money. If yes, then there are four ways to learn, how to do this:

1. One thing you can do is, take your idea to the developer who can build an app for you.

2. You can use an online program builder tool that requires little or no programming.

3. You should learn how to convert a program developed in HTML or other programs for use on the iPhone.

4. You can learn to develop your own apps by learning all the programs and skills yourself.

First of all, you need to decide whether you want to use “web app” or “native app”, after considering all the pros and cons of each approach.

Once you proceed it is necessary for you to know about the apps.

What is a web app?

A web app is fundamentally a website that is specifically designed for or modified for the iPhone. You can use various tools to adapt an existing website for use. It is built with web technologies like HTML, JavaScript etc. If you can build a website, then you can develop a basic web app. You need a URL and link, most of the functions and hardware are not available for you. The Web app is installed on the phone like a native app and not available in the iTunes app store and it is not written in Objective – C.

Pros:

Web developers can use the tools what they know and they can modify the current web design and use existing development skills.
Not limited to Mac OS.
The app can run on any device that has a web browser like Blackberry, Android, etc…
Bugs fix in real time and not require the users to upload revised versions of their phone.
The development cycle is much faster.
Cons:

Hardware access is not available.
You must develop your own payment system if you want to charge for the app.
What is a Native App?

A native app is developed using the iPhone system and is installed on the iPhone. The application can use all hardware like speakers, accelerometer, camera, etc. It is available in the iTunes App store which increases their appeal for users. But means that the apps have to be submitted to apple and approved.

Pros:

There are excellent tools available through the registration of Xcode, Interface Builder, and the Cocoa Touch framework.
You can access all the excellent hardware features.
After considering all these pros and cons, now you have to decide which way you want to go ahead.

1. You can take your idea to the developer who can build an app for you.

There are several developers who will work with you and create a program for your idea and make it registered with the app store. They will fully develop the native or web app for you for an upfront fee, a monthly fee or a share of the profits.

2. You can use online program builder tool that requires little or no programming.

You can use online tools that can use to build your own apps from the templates and various tools any functions, which have the templates and tools. There are some general online app builders that are designed for general business and entertainment needs and more specific ones that target specific needs. Some of the others allow the developers familiar with HTML and Java Scripts to write the code with a specific knowledge of development. It would be nice if you know HTML, Ruby, Java, JavaScript, CSS, Python, PHP.

3. Develop your own apps by learning all the programs and skills yourself.

It may be you need to play various roles for the programming skills and understand the iPhone system, you have to be a researcher, creator, idea developer, entrepreneur, project manager, information architect, user information designer, accountant, developer, marketer and advertiser.

You need some aspect to work on an iPhone app, that includes:

You must have an ability to know what works and what doesn’t work for existing systems.
You should have market research skills to find out what is in demand.
Graphic and layout design.
Graphic user interface design, and so on.

B2B Portal Development: A Few Merits Unlocked

What does successful B2B portal development entail in its entirety? Ask your peers and they will probably tell you that it’s a combination of different levels of skills including DB planning, GUI design architecture design and middle tier integration and coding. Now ask yourself. Would you believe that the possible conversion of your website into a B2B portal can actually result in significant improvement in the growth of revenue and that all this can happen in a month? Probably, a few years ago you wouldn’t have believed it but today you are left with no choice but to admit the sheer power of B2B portals as far as shaping your entrepreneurial fortunes are concerned.

If You Are Yet to Explore Its True Potential Then You’re Lagging

Gone are the days when a B2B portal was primarily regarded as a fancy idea – primarily maintained by larger companies. Today, businesses, irrespective of what their size is have unequivocally admitted that quality B2B portals are backed by serious merits. They are an absolute necessity for each and every company looking for substantial revenue growth without shelling out a fortune for the same. Here are ways in which B2B portals can turn out to be an absolutely sagacious investment for your business.

Aim for Better Targeted Campaigns With The Help Of These Portals

These portals are designed to bolster targeted campaigns. There is no dearth of B2B portals focused on individual industry networks and industries consisting of members from across the globe. There are portals that concentrate on regional divisions as well. An effective B2B marketing strategy would be to integrate several portals in order to obtain substantial coverage. There are around 1500 such portals and online directories based on variations in their regional and industry focus.

Expect Better Revenue Growth with Existing Client Base and Value Added Services

Both your present customer base as well as value added services can positively serve as avenues of profit. Thanks to these integrated portals, your existing clients are able to secure faster access to product information as well as improved customer support services. As far as leveraging your value added services is concerned, you can establish the portal as the primary sales channel and then you can use the shared resources to add value to the client experience.

Utilize Low-Cost Effective Marketing

At the core of the emergence of B2B portals as one of the most dominant forces driving sales is their cost-effectiveness. Yes. Portal marketing is an essentially low-cost marketing activity. To start off with, you can even open a free account with these portals only to switch to a premium account soon. Let us tell you that this premium account is not expensive as well. With a premium account, you can expect better visibility on Google and multilingual entries, in a few cases as well. Businesses that have premium accounts in these portals are positioned better in the search results and clicked more as well.

In order to leverage the true potential of B2B portals, you need to ensure that you’re seeking services of a reliable B2B Portal Development company- which has the proven record of developing successful portals for businesses.

Older posts »